Ingredients for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ice

Gather these items:

  • 2 tablespoons Extra Virgin Olive Oil (Can substitute with melted butter.)
  • 1 head Cauliflower (Riced, fresh preferred.)
  • 1 head Broccoli (Riced.)
  • to taste Salt
  • to taste Pepper (Optional.)
  • 2 tablespoons Butter (Can be replaced with more olive oil for a dairy-free version.)
  • 1 cup Heavy Whipping Cream (Substitute with whole milk for a lighter sauce.)
  • 1 teaspoon Mustard Powder (Can be omitted or replaced with Dijon mustard.)
  • 1.5 cups Sharp Cheddar Cheese (Shredded from a block enhances melting quality.)

How to Make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ice Step-by-Step

  1. Step 1: In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oil over medium-high heat.
  2. Step 2: Add the riced cauliflower and broccoli into the skillet, seasoning generously with salt and pepper. Sauté for about 8-9 minutes.
  3. Step 3: Once the vegetables are cooked, transfer them to a large bowl and set aside. Clean the skillet.
  4. Step 4: Return the cleaned skillet to medium heat and melt 2 tablespoons of butter. Whisk in 1 cup of heavy whipping cream and 1 teaspoon of mustard powder.
  5. Step 5: Stir in 1 ½ cups of shredded sharp cheddar cheese until melted and smooth.
  6. Step 6: Fold the cooked vegetable mixture back into the skillet with the cheese sauce and stir for an additional 2-3 minutes.
  7. Step 7: Remove from heat and serve hot, garnishing with extra cheese if desired.

Pro Tips for the Perfect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ice

Keep these in mind:

  • Using fresh vegetables for ricing will enhance the flavor.
  • For a richer flavor, consider using a combination of cheeses like mozzarella and cheddar.
  • Adjust the amount of mustard powder according to your taste preference.
  • This dish is best served immediately, but you can also prepare it ahead of time and reheat.

How to Store and Reheat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ice

If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. To reheat, simply warm it in a skillet over low heat, adding a splash of cream or milk to maintain creaminess. This makes it an excellent choice for meal prep!

Frequently Asked Questions About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ice

What is cheesy broccoli cauliflower rice?

This dish combines riced cauliflower and broccoli with a creamy cheese sauce, making it a low-carb, gluten-free alternative to traditional rice dishes.

Can I make cheesy broccoli cauliflower rice 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are this dish in advance and store it in the refrigerator. Reheat it on the stovetop before serving for optimal flavor.

How do I avoid common mistakes with cheesy broccoli cauliflower rice?

To prevent a watery texture, ensure the vegetables are well-drained before mixing them with the cheese sauce. Overcooking can also lead to mushiness.

Variations of Cheesy Broccoli Cauliflower Rice You Can Try

If you’re looking to mix things up, consider these variations:

  • Add cooked bacon or ham for added protein.
  • Incorporate other vegetables like bell peppers or spinach for a colorful twist.
  • Use different types of cheese, such as gouda or pepper jack, for a unique flavor profile.
